Sans Superellipse Rudov 8 is a bold, very narrow, medium contrast, upright, normal x-height font.

A tall, tightly set sans with compact proportions and a strong vertical rhythm. Curves resolve into rounded-rectangle forms rather than purely circular bowls, giving letters like C, O, and G a controlled, superelliptical feel. Strokes stay largely uniform with subtle modulation, and terminals are clean and squared-off in places, producing crisp edges and clear counters despite the narrow set. Lowercase shows simple, sturdy constructions with single-storey a and g, and the figures follow the same condensed, high-contrast-in-silhouette structure for consistent color in text and headlines.
Best suited to headlines, subheads, posters, and branding where horizontal space is limited but impact is needed. It also works well for packaging and editorial display settings that benefit from a condensed, modern texture and consistent rhythm across mixed-case text and numerals.
The overall tone is assertive and contemporary, with a slightly industrial, poster-like presence. Its compressed geometry reads efficient and focused, lending a no-nonsense voice that still feels refined enough for editorial display.
The design appears intended to deliver maximum presence in minimal width, pairing condensed proportions with rounded-rectangle geometry for a distinctive, modern display voice. It aims for legibility through simplified forms and clear counters while maintaining a strong, compact typographic color.
Because of the narrow widths, spacing and fit feel intentionally compact; the design relies on tall ascenders/caps and simplified shapes to maintain clarity. The superelliptical rounding adds warmth without softening the overall, high-impact texture.
